copyright vs. Ethereum: A Tale of Two Blockchains
The copyright landscape is a volatile one, with numerous options vying for attention. Among these, Bitcoin and Ethereum stand out as the two most dominant players. Both harness blockchain technology, but their applications diverge significantly. Bitcoin, the original digital asset, emerged as a decentralized system for secure financial transactions. Ethereum, on the other hand, aims to be a comprehensive platform for developing blockchain solutions. This core difference in objective shapes their respective communities, leading to a persistent debate about which blockchain truly reigns supreme.
- Bitcoin's primary function as a digital gold contrasts with Ethereum's emphasis on programmability.
- Scalability remains a impediment for both blockchains, though Ethereum is actively developing solutions like layer-2 scaling.
- Security are paramount for both Bitcoin and Ethereum, but their implementations differ, leading to unique strengths.
